The core functionality of this photoelectric switch is based on the interruption of a light beam. The emitter component projects a concentrated beam of light towards the receiver. When an object passes between them, it breaks this beam, causing the receiver's output state to change. This change is a clean, digital signal—typically switching from "on" to "off" or vice-versa—that is instantly communicated to a programmable logic controller (PLC) or other control system. This simple yet effective principle makes it ideal for tasks such as counting objects on a conveyor belt, detecting the presence of components in an assembly machine, or ensuring a safety curtain is not breached.

Key technical features contribute to its reliability. The M12 connection ensures a secure, vibration-resistant electrical link with standard 4-pin M12 connectors, commonly wired for both power supply (10-30V DC) and the switched output (often PNP or NPN). The housing is frequently rated at IP67, meaning it is completely protected against dust and can withstand temporary immersion in water, making it suitable for washdown areas in food processing or outdoor applications. The visible light spot also simplifies alignment during setup and maintenance, a significant practical advantage over infrared sensors.

Selecting and implementing this sensor requires consideration of several factors. The operating environment is crucial; while robust, extreme temperatures, heavy condensation, or direct exposure to strong ambient light might require additional protective housings or filters. The properties of the target object—its size, color, and material—must be compatible with the sensor's beam type and range. For the through-beam variant, precise mechanical mounting and alignment of the separate emitter and receiver units are essential for optimal performance. Regular maintenance, primarily lens cleaning to prevent buildup of dust or grime, ensures long-term operational integrity.
